Grade 3 Babbitt Metal vs. EN 1.4821 Stainless Steel

Grade 3 Babbitt Metal belongs to the otherwise unclassified metals classification, while EN 1.4821 stainless steel belongs to the iron alloys. There are 18 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(16,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is grade 3 Babbitt Metal and the bottom bar is EN 1.4821 stainless steel.
